Adolf Heinrich Lier market snapshot
Adolf Heinrich Lier shows developing auction liquidity with 45 tracked lots. Median realized sale is around $2,000. Category concentration is still broad or sparse. Last 12 months recorded 3 sales. Latest recorded sale: 2025-12-06.
Realized price distribution
- Under $1,000 (33.3% · 8 sales)
- $1,000 to $10,000 (62.5% · 15 sales)
- $10,000+ (4.2% · 1 sales)

Artist context
About Adolf Heinrich Lier
Born
1826
Died
1882
Nationality
German
Adolf Heinrich Lier (1826–1882) was a German landscape painter. The collected identity sources consistently connect his name with landscape painting, while the French biographical record gives Herrnhut as his birthplace and Vahrn as the place of his death.
